Torrance Real Estate Market

The Torrance real estate market remains competitive, with homes ranging from $650,000 to $2.5 million. Recent trends show steady appreciation driven by strong local schools, community amenities, and proximity to South Bay employment centers. Inventory typically moves quickly, with homes averaging 25-40 days on market. Buyer demand remains robust from families relocating to the area and investors recognizing Torrance's long-term value potential in the greater Los Angeles market.

💰 Price Range

Torrance home prices typically range from $650,000 for condos to $2.5 million for premium single-family homes. Median prices hover around $1.2 million for standard residential properties. Luxury waterfront and hillside estates command premiums. Prices vary significantly by neighborhood proximity to beaches, schools, and employment centers.

🏠 Buyer Tips

Get pre-approved for financing before house hunting to strengthen offers in this competitive market. Research school ratings and neighborhood characteristics carefully. Consider proximity to your workplace and major freeways. Schedule home inspections and factor in HOA fees. Work with a local Torrance agent familiar with market trends. Attend open houses to understand pricing and available inventory. Be prepared to act quickly on properties that meet your criteria.

🔑 Seller Tips

Stage your home to highlight natural light and outdoor spaces popular in Torrance. Price competitively using recent comparable sales data. Invest in professional photography to showcase curb appeal. Consider minor upgrades to kitchens and bathrooms for maximum ROI. List during spring or early summer for optimal buyer traffic. Disclose all HOA information and Mello-Roos assessments upfront. Work with experienced agents who understand local market dynamics and buyer preferences.

About Torrance

Torrance is a premier South Bay destination featuring award-winning schools, beautiful parks, and safe, well-maintained neighborhoods. The community offers excellent shopping at Del Amo Fashion Center, diverse dining options, and recreational facilities including golf courses and beach access. Torrance's planned community design provides tree-lined streets, excellent infrastructure, and strong neighborhood associations. Proximity to LAX, Port of Los Angeles employment, and South Bay tech companies makes it ideal for commuters. The area balances suburban tranquility with urban convenience.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average home price in Torrance? +
The median home price in Torrance is approximately $1.2 million, with condominiums starting around $650,000 and luxury estates reaching $2.5 million or more. Prices vary based on location, size, condition, and proximity to beaches and top-rated schools.
Are Torrance schools highly rated? +
Yes, Torrance Unified School District is nationally recognized for academic excellence. Elementary schools, middle schools, and Torrance High School consistently rank among California's best, making the area highly desirable for families seeking quality education.
How far is Torrance from the beach? +
Torrance is approximately 3-5 miles from beautiful South Bay beaches including Torrance Beach and Redondo Beach. Most neighborhoods enjoy easy beach access within 10-15 minutes, perfect for weekend activities and coastal lifestyle enthusiasts.
What is the commute like from Torrance? +
Torrance offers convenient freeway access via I-405 and I-110 for commuting to downtown Los Angeles, Long Beach, and throughout Los Angeles County. Many residents also work locally at South Bay tech companies, the Port of Los Angeles, or nearby business centers.
Do homes in Torrance have HOA fees? +
Many Torrance neighborhoods have HOA communities with monthly fees typically ranging from $200-$600, covering maintenance, landscaping, and amenities. Some non-HOA neighborhoods exist. Always review HOA documents and Mello-Roos assessments during the purchase process.
